Read this passage from Aesop's fables and

answer the question that follows.
A Native American grandfather was talking
to his grandson about how he felt. He said,
"I feel as if I have two wolves fighting in my
heart. One wolf is the vengeful, angry,
violent one. The other wolf is the loving,
compassionate one." The grandson asked
him, "Which wolf will win the fight in your
heart?" The grandfather answered: "The
one I feed."
What is the moral of this story?
A)We are what we choose to become.
B)We are violent by nature.
